## CI Troubleshooting: Stale Cache in Plugin Builds

Following the Fernwick stale-cache incident, the Loomhaven CI runners now key plugin caches on a combined hash of the lockfile and the plugin manifest version. If your plugin picks up outdated dependencies, confirm you bumped the manifest version — a lockfile-only change no longer invalidates the cache by itself. Clearing caches manually is rarely needed and should be a last resort. When filing a report, include the trace token printed below your build summary.

trace token, fawig-fawef: htk3_0ee

## Restock Planner: Manual Rerun

If the Fillwise nightly plan fails, check the `machines_stale` view first. Over 50 stale rows means telemetry lag — wait an hour, then rerun `fillwise plan --force`. Never rerun twice inside 15 minutes; duplicate purchase orders result. The planner reads inventory from the database reachable via the connection string below.

warehouse DSN: mssql://rusdor_svc:0FSWCn9@db-951a.paliqforge.local:5432/ulawyn

Subject: Lift maintenance this weekend

Night team,

All passenger lifts at Danbury Exchange will be out of service from Saturday 23:00 to Sunday 06:00 while Keldon Vertical carries out inspections. Use stairwell B for floors 1–6; stairwell A remains alarmed. The goods lift stays live for emergencies only. Engineers will sign in at the night desk and need escorting to the motor room on the roof level. The roof-level door takes the pass below.

turnstile pass: bdg-FVNQRS-72965873